Hello, I'm new here and hoping that someone can help me. For about the past six months or so I’ve been experiencing horrible headaches. They usually start out as a regular dull headache all over my head, and gradually move to one side of my head, always the right temple. Then, it throbs constantly and nothing I do can make it go away. Regular over the counter pain killers do nothing, and the ONLY way for me to make it go away is to go to sleep, and when i wake up, it's gone.
I've already been to my doctor about it and he thought they were caused by a very tight neck muscle, which he gave me a shot to relax the muscle, and left it at that. He also thought it could be my birth control pills, which i thought it might be too. But I’ve switched to three different birth control brands and nothing has changed. My headaches follow no patterns as to when they come. I usually experience at least one a week, sometimes more.
My mother thinks they might still be due to my very tight neck muscles and wants to send me to the chiropractor about it.
Has anyone else experienced these types of headaches? Or does anyone know what they might be caused by?
Thanks so much for your help :)
